We compare two popular WW2 Skirmish rules, Bolt Action by Warlord Games and Chain of Command by Too Fat Lardies. We provide an in-depth look at their strengths, weaknesses, layout, mechanics, support, and much more. By then end you should have a good idea of what types of game play you can get from each set and which might best suit your play style.
